Migrating to the cloud includes several key actions: Assess the existing IT infrastructure, applications and work to figure out cloud readiness. Develop an in-depth migration plan (consisting of timelines, resource allotment and danger management techniques). Conduct pilot tests to identify potential problems and improve the migration process. Perform the migration plan, guaranteeing minimal disruption to business operations.

A number of emerging technologies are poised to assist the future of cloud computing: Cloud platforms are increasingly incorporating AI and ML abilities, making it possible for services to develop intelligent applications and automate procedures.
Serverless architecture permits services to run applications without managing the underlying facilities, minimizing functional complexity and expenses. While still in its early phases, quantum computing has the possible to resolve complex problems that are beyond the capabilities of classical computers, opening brand-new avenues for innovation. A number of cloud computing case research studies have proven the efficiency of this extremely versatile computing tool.
A prominent example of this impact is Siemens' cooperation with Amazon Web Services (AWS) to execute a cloud-based service for enhancing alert management. The outcomes proved positive on many levels, from minimizing power plant alerts by 90%, which lessened operational noise, to attaining expense savings by leveraging the pay-as-you-go model of AWS servicesamong numerous other benefits.
